Sizing reference for Agile Service Manager on OCP (Watson AIOps)
This topic only describes the sizing requirements for a stand-alone Private Cloud deployment of Agile Service Manager on RedHat OpenShift Container Platform for IBM Watson AIOps.

The following table illustrates the recommended resource allocation for the OCP Master and Worker
nodes, along with the recommended configuration for the disk volumes associated with each persisted
storage resource. Worker nodes may be larger when Agile Service Manager standalone is deployed along
with other applications.
Category | Resource | Demo/PoC/Trial | Production | smallProduction |
---|---|---|---|---|
OCP Control Plane (Master) Node(s) | Minimum Nodes Count | 1 | 3 | 3 |
CPU cores and memory requirements | x86 CPUs | 4 | 4 | 4 |
Memory (GB) (Min) | 16 | 16 | 16 | |
Disk (GB) (Min) | 120 | 120 | 120 | |
Agile Service Manager standalone components suggested configuration | ||||
OCP Compute (Worker) Nodes | Minimum Nodes Count | 1 | 3 | 3 |
CPU cores and memory requirements | x86 CPUs | 4 | 11 | 3 |
Memory (GB) | 16 | 24 | 20 | |
Disk (GB) | 120 | 120 | 120 | |
Persistent storage min Requirements (Gi) | Cassandra | 200 | 1500 | 200 |
Kafka | 150 | 300 | 60 | |
Zookeeper | 15 | 30 | 15 | |
Elasticsearch | 450 | 900 | 200 | |
File Observer | 5 | 10 | 5 | |
Persistent storage recommended IOPS Requirements | Cassandra | 600 | 2400 | 2400 |
Kafka | 300 | 2400 | 2400 | |
Zookeeper | 50 | 150 | 150 | |
Elasticsearch | 300 | 2400 | 2400 | |
File Observer | 50 | 100 | 100 |
